My classroom uses both a teacher and student centered learning approach. Each project/unit I introduce starts with a keynote to introduce and/or review any new content. Next we look at a featured artist, their work, then discuss our learning objectives and project details! The demonstrations we do in class are either done in-person or include step-by-step photos included in our keynotes. From there kids move into their own work time and complete projects at their own pace before completing an artist statement and updating their class portfolio via Seesaw or Google Classroom!
